What Makes Ocean Pier Construction Different

Ocean piers face significantly greater forces than inland or bay structures. Constant wave action, changing tides, storm surge, boat wake, and corrosive saltwater all place ongoing stress on the structure.


A properly built ocean pier must account for:


  • Load-bearing requirements for people, equipment, and vessels
  • Soil and seabed conditions beneath the waterline
  • Tidal fluctuation and wave energy patterns
  • Wind and storm exposure
  • Long-term material durability in a saltwater environment

Materials Built for Ocean Conditions

Material selection is critical when building in open water. Using the wrong materials can lead to premature failure, costly repairs, and safety risks.


Sea Byrd Marine uses marine-grade materials selected for strength, corrosion resistance, and long-term performance, including:

Pressure-treated or composite decking rated for marine use

Heavy-duty timber, concrete, or steel pilings

Corrosion-resistant hardware and fasteners

Reinforced framing systems engineered for wave impact

Pile Driving and Foundation Installation

The foundation is the most critical component of any ocean pier. Improper pile depth or spacing can compromise the entire structure.

Sea Byrd Marine performs professional pile driving using proven marine construction techniques to ensure pilings are driven to the proper depth and alignment based on soil conditions and load requirements.


Our foundation work is designed to:

Resist lateral wave and current forces

Prevent shifting or settlement over time

Support long spans and heavy loads

Maintain stability during storm events
